The US immigration agency at the center of a firestorm over heavy-handed enforcement tactics began deploying Monday to major airports, as officials scrambled to ease mounting travel disruption during a prolonged, partial government shutdown.

The move places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E) personnel -- already under intense scrutiny after fatal shootings linked to immigration operations -- in highly visible roles at crowded transport hubs across the country.
